The Rise of Green Nanotechnology
Nanotechnology has revolutionized various fields, ranging from cosmetics and electronics to medicine and agriculture. Most conventional methods of synthesizing nanoparticles, however, involve the use of toxic chemicals, high energy usage, and the generation of dangerous wastes. These processes are detrimental to human health as well as the environment, raising doubt about their long-term sustainability.

Taking center stage is green nanotechnology, the innovative, ecofriendly solution. Leading the charge is Torskal, which uses plant extracts and natural reductants in its green synthesis of gold nanoparticles, completely doing away with the use of toxins. Not only is this approach environmentally sustainable, but it delivers nanoparticles with higher biocompatibility as well as therapeutic action.

Scientific Innovation with Global Impact
Torskal’s green technology for gold nanoparticles is patented, allowing for controlled size, shape, and surface features—a critical group of parameters affecting their performance in biological applications. The company is currently manufacturing gold nanoparticles of different sizes (specifically, 15nm and 40nm), optimized for use in applications such as:

Targeted drug delivery: Allowing direct delivery of therapeutic compounds directly to the sites of tumor growth, minimizing side effects while increasing efficacy

Near-infrared laser photothermal therapy (nanophototherapy): Near infrared light is used to heat gold nanoparticles, killing cancer cells but not neighboring healthy tissue.

Imaging and diagnostics: Increasing the contrast in imaging methods such as MRI and CT scans for increased accuracy in disease detection at an earlier stage.

Green nanoparticles are particularly promising for applications in oncology. Preclinical research demonstrates Torskal’s biocompatible nanoparticles of gold are tolerated in the human system extensively without any adverse effects. They can be accurately localized in cancerous cells, minimizing toxicity while achieving maximum therapeutic effects—holding out the possibility of safer, more effective treatments for patients.

Green Production, High-Performance Product
Torskal’s green chemistry method leverages the antioxidant potentials of plant extracts found in La Réunion plants as well as other tropical plants, famed for their antioxidant content. Natural compounds function as reducing as well as stabilizing reagents in gold nanoparticles syntheses without the use of chemical reagents like sodium borohydride or hydrazine.

This approach offers several benefits:

Non-toxic and biodegradable end products

Lower environmental impact

Scalability and affordability

High Dispersion and Stability in Biological Media
